Caffe has already been included in 'external/caffe' and follow the below steps to install caffe with only CPU: (1) Change directory to 'external/caffe/' and change 'MATLAB_DIR' in 'Makefile.config' to the path of your own matlab. E.g., MATLAB_DIR := path/to/my/matlab (2) Run 'make clean' in your terminal before compile. (3) Run 'make -j8 && make matcaffe' to compile caffe.

- version 'GLIBCXX_3.4.9' not found
solution: type 'LD_PRELOAD=/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libstdc++.so.6 matlab' in terminal to open matlab.
